在Eiffel中,可以使用标准库中的math
模块来使用Sine、Cosine、Tan和Sqrt等数学函数。下面是使用这些函数的示例:
local
x: REAL_64
do
x := math.sin(1.0) -- 计算1.0的正弦值
end
Sine函数返回一个实数的正弦值。
local
x: REAL_64
do
x := math.cos(1.0) -- 计算1.0的余弦值
end
Cosine函数返回一个实数的余弦值。
local
x: REAL_64
do
x := math.tan(1.0) -- 计算1.0的正切值
end
Tan函数返回一个实数的正切值。
local
x: REAL_64
do
x := math.sqrt(4.0) -- 计算4.0的平方根
end
Sqrt函数返回一个实数的平方根。
Eiffel是一种面向对象的编程语言,它具有强类型和静态类型检查的特性。Eiffel语言的优势在于其可读性、可靠性和可维护性。它适用于开发大型软件系统,并且具有良好的软件工程实践。
在Eiffel中使用这些数学函数可以帮助开发人员进行数值计算、科学计算和图形处理等任务。这些函数在各种领域都有广泛的应用,如物理学、工程学、金融学等。
腾讯云提供了丰富的云计算产品和服务,其中包括计算、存储、数据库、人工智能等方面的解决方案。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多相关产品和服务的详细信息。
领取专属 10元无门槛券
手把手带您无忧上云